Tickets have gone on sale for next year’s event at Symmons Plains in Tasmania.

The Repco Supercars Championship will return to Symmons Plains Raceway for the second round of the 2022 season.

The upcoming Tasmania SuperSprint will be the 49th ATCC/Supercars event at the 2.4km circuit.

Only Sandown Motor Raceway has hosted more championship events.

The short yet fast circuit made its championship debut in 1969, with Norm Beechey steering a Holden Monaro GTS 327 to victory.

In 48 visits, 29 drivers have won races, with the now retired Jamie Whincup leading the way with a staggering 13 wins.
